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Bossie, is still a very hot month, with an average temperature varying between 35.6°C (96.1°F) and 24°C (75.2°F).

Temperature

The shift into June records an average high-temperature of a still torrid 35.6°C (96.1°F), subtly varied from May's 37.5°C (99.5°F). In June, Bossie experiences an average nighttime temperature of 24°C (75.2°F).

Heat index

During June, the heat index is evaluated at a life-threatening hot 47°C (116.6°F). Stay vigilant: Heat cramps along with heat exhaustion are expected. Heatstroke may follow prolonged exertion.
Bear in mind that the heat index values are determined for shaded areas and light breezes. With direct sunlight, the heat index could incre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'real feel', unifies temperature and humidity readings to offer a comprehensive feel of warmth. The individual's impression of temperature can be affected by numerous factors such as metabolic variations, physical exertion, and attire. When exposed to direct sunlight, it's possible for the heat index to increase by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ly important for children. Young ones generally face higher dangers than adults since they sweat less. Along with their large skin surface area compared totheir small bodies and increased heat production from their activities, the risks are heightened.
The human body keeps its cool primarily through perspiration, as this process enables sweat to evaporate, taking away the excess heat. During high air temperature and humidity (high heat index), the process of perspiration is hindered, intensifying the sensation of heat. When body temperature rises due to excess heat gain beyond its removal capability, one might experience heat-related disorders.

Humidity

In June, the average relative humidity is 60%.

Rainfall

In Bossie, in June, it is raining for 14.6 days, with typically 48mm (1.89")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 129.7 rainfall days, and 548mm (21.57")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

With an average of 12h and 42min of daylight, June has the longest days of the year.
On the first day of June, sunrise is at 05:53 and sunset at 18:34.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:58 and sunset at 18:41 GMT.

Sunshine

In Bossie, the average sunshine in June is 11.2h.

UV index

In June, the average daily maximum UV index is 7.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: A maximum UV index of 7 in June translates into the following recommendations:
Conform to measures and uphold sun safety traditions. Warding off skin and eye harm is necessary. Stay out of direct sunlight and seek shade between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is strongest, but remember that shade devices may not offer full sun protection. Outfit yourself in sun-safe attire, like long sleeves, pants, a hat, and UV-blocking sunglasses.

Average temperature in June
Bossie, Burkina Faso
  • Average high temperature in June: 35.6°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is April (39.1°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is August (29.8°C).

  • Average low temperature in June: 24°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is April (26.7°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(19.4°C).
